Significant differences between Tortilla and Cream cheese

  • Tortilla has more Iron, Vitamin B1, Vitamin B3, Folate, Selenium, Manganese, Fiber, and Copper, however, Cream cheese is richer in Vitamin B2.
  • Cream cheese covers your daily Saturated Fat needs 100% more than Tortilla.
  • Tortilla contains less Saturated Fat.

Specific food types used in this comparison are Tortilla, includes plain and from mutton sandwich (Navajo) and Cheese, cream.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Tortilla Cream cheese Opinion
Net carbs 47.54g 5.52g Tortilla
Protein 7.28g 6.15g Tortilla
Fats 0.95g 34.44g Cream cheese
Carbs 49.94g 5.52g Tortilla
Calories 237kcal 350kcal Cream cheese
Starch 43.02g 0.35g Tortilla
Sugar 2.75g 3.76g Tortilla
Fiber 2.4g 0g Tortilla
Calcium 70mg 97mg Cream cheese
Iron 3.81mg 0.11mg Tortilla
Magnesium 19mg 9mg Tortilla
Phosphorus 146mg 107mg Tortilla
Potassium 105mg 132mg Cream cheese
Sodium 482mg 314mg Cream cheese
Zinc 0.32mg 0.5mg Cream cheese
Copper 0.102mg 0.018mg Tortilla
Manganese 0.268mg 0.011mg Tortilla
Selenium 16.6µg 8.6µg Tortilla
